What is PFB (Printer Font Binary)?

PFB (Printer Font Binary) is the binary companion format to PFA, used in Adobe's Type 1 font system. It contains the same font information as PFA but in a compact binary format.

PFB files are more space-efficient than their PFA counterparts and were commonly used in Windows systems for PostScript Type 1 fonts.

The format stores vector outlines of font characters, hinting information, and metrics data needed for accurate text rendering in print and display applications.

How to open PFB files?

PFB files can be installed and used with font management tools like Adobe Type Manager, Adobe Fonts Folder, or Windows Font Viewer.

For editing PFB files, professional font design software such as FontLab Studio, Fontographer, or FontForge is required.

Unlike PFA files, PFB files cannot be meaningfully viewed in standard text editors due to their binary nature.

PFB is Developed by: Adobe Systems

PFB was Released on: 1985

What is AVIF (AV1 Image File Format)?

AVIF (AV1 Image File Format) is a cutting-edge image format that provides superior compression and quality. It supports HDR and transparency, making it a perfect choice for modern web applications. Supported extension includes .avif.

AVIF files offer significant reductions in file size compared to traditional formats like JPEG and PNG while maintaining excellent visual fidelity. They are gaining popularity for web optimization and next-gen media.

How to open AVIF?

Opening AVIF files is becoming easier as support grows across various platforms and applications. On Windows, you can use the latest versions of Google Chrome or Microsoft Edge to view AVIF images. Additionally, software like Adobe Photoshop (with plugins) and IrfanView support AVIF.

For Mac users, browsers like Safari and Chrome offer native AVIF support. Applications like Preview may require updates or plugins to handle AVIF files. Linux users can utilize applications like GIMP or specialized plugins for viewing and editing AVIF images. If you encounter issues, ensure your software is up-to-date or try an alternative viewer.

AVIF is Developed by: Alliance for Open Media

AVIF was Released on: 2019
